Microgrids are localized grids that can operate independently or in conjunction with the main power grid. They are designed to enhance energy reliability, reduce costs, and support sustainable energy solutions. A typical microgrid setup includes several key components: generation sources. [PDF Version]

Although private power producers generate more than half of Thailand's electricity, the wholesale market and grid operations are dominated by three state-owned utilities. As such, government procurement plays a key role in the deployment of new infrastructure. Thailand's grid remains heavily. . Solar is the most affordable new source of power 3.2. Distributed wind assets are often installed to offset retail power costs or secure long term power cost certainty, support grid operations and local loads, and electrify remote locations not connected to a centralized grid. However, there are technical barriers to fully realizing these benefits. .
